Access is Denied error in trying to create connection

I'm trying to create a new ODBC or OLE DB connection in Sense, and I'm getting an Access is Denied error message. When I test the connection (using SQL authentication) the connection validates, but when I choose "Create", it fails. I have Root Admin and Content Admin, but there must be something I'm missing. Any ideas?

1 Solution

Accepted Solutions
Not applicable
Author

Ended up figuring it out. Changed the ContentAdmin security rule to apply to Hub and QMC as opposed to QMC only.
